- English Word Render Definition To cause to be, or to become; as, to render a person more safe or more unsafe; to render a fortress secure.
- English Word Render Definition To translate from one language into another; as, to render Latin into English.
- English Word Render Definition To interpret; to set forth, represent, or exhibit; as, an actor renders his part poorly; a singer renders a passage of music with great effect; a painter renders a scene in a felicitous manner.
- English Word Render Definition To try out or extract (oil, lard, tallow, etc.) from fatty animal substances; as, to render tallow.
- English Word Render Definition To plaster, as a wall of masonry, without the use of lath.
- English Word Render Definition To give an account; to make explanation or confession.
- English Word Render Definition To pass; to run; -- said of the passage of a rope through a block, eyelet, etc.; as, a rope renders well, that is, passes freely; also, to yield or give way.
- English Word Render Definition A surrender.
- English Word Render Definition A return; a payment of rent.
- English Word Render Definition An account given; a statement.
- English Word Renderable Definition Capable of being rendered.
- English Word Rendered Definition of Render
- English Word Renderer Definition One who renders.
- English Word Renderer Definition A vessel in which lard or tallow, etc., is rendered.
- English Word Rendering Definition of Render
- English Word Rendering Definition The act of one who renders, or that which is rendered.
- English Word Rendering Definition A version; translation; as, the rendering of the Hebrew text.
- English Word Rendering Definition In art, the presentation, expression, or interpretation of an idea, theme, or part.
- English Word Rendering Definition The act of laying the first coat of plaster on brickwork or stonework.
- English Word Rendering Definition The coat of plaster thus laid on.
